UC observes ‘Fight Against Sexual Exploitation’

Women development cell, Unity College (UC) Dimapur observed “World Day of Fight against Sexual Exploitation” on March 4 by visiting Prodigal Home (Swadhar Greh and Child Care Institute) Fellowship Colony Dimapur.
During the visit, Phengna Konyak, coordinator of the centre, highlighted the staff and students about the Prodigal Home and how they carry out their social work and projects and other outreach programs. The visiting team interacted with the children and conducted activities for children. Four groups consisting of four students each were engaged for case study, where they were allowed to interact with the inmates keeping their identity confidential.
